Location guide
The town of Newquay, located on the western coast of the United Kingdom, is renowned for its surfing conditions. It's often regarded as the surfing capital of the UK, and for good reason. The vast expanse of the Atlantic Ocean adjacent to Newquay provides consistent, high-quality waves that attract surfers from all over the world. The charm of Newquay's surfing conditions lies in its variety. There are a number of key beaches, each having its own unique characteristics that provide an exhilarating challenge for surfers of all skill levels. Fistral Beach, probably the most famous among them, is known for its powerful, long peeling waves. The wave conditions are consistent throughout the year, but it's during the summer months when they are the most pleasing, catering to both beginners as well as seasoned surfers. The other notable spot is Watergate Bay. This two-mile-long stretch of sandy beach offers quite a different surfing experience. Depending on the tide, the waves here can range from gentle, long-wave beach breaks for beginners to high, hollow peaks for experienced riders. Regardless of your surfing expertise, Watergate Bay is sure to test your mettle. Adding to the surfing appeal of Newqauy is its vibrant beach culture, coupled with extensive surfing facilities and services. There are numerous surf schools located at each beach, run by veteran surfers familiar with the local conditions, well-equipped to provide lessons or offer advice. The weather plays a key role in shaping the surf conditions at Newquay. The water temperature varies drastically from icy cold in winter to mildly warm in the summer. Therefore, the right surf-wear is essential if you plan to surf here. But don't be put off by the cooler temperatures as winter brings heavy swells that result in cleaner and bigger waves, a rewarding surfing experience for the adventurous ones. In essence, Newquay offers excellent surfing conditions throughout the year, with its range of beaches each presenting their own unique challenges and experiences. The spirit of the vibrant surf culture, coupled with the raw beauty of the coastal landscape and the consistency of the waves, makes Newquay one of the foremost surfing destinations in the UK and, indeed, Europe.
